Maguire Tames Trump

Stephen Maguire came from behind to beat Judd Trump 6-4 while Neil Robertson repeated the scoreline against Robert Milkins on the second day of the Masters. Dott Denies Robertson Comeback

Graeme Dott survived an almost unbelievable fight back from reigning champion Neil Robertson to reach the quarter-finals of the UK Championship after a dramatic 6-5 victory.
